从Facebook个人资料链接获取用户ID的API

6
有没有一种方式(使用API)可以从Facebook的个人资料链接中获取用户的uid?

我认为在这件事上你可能运气不佳。 - jlb
这个问题需要重新审查,因为用户名查询已被弃用。 - Seif El-Din Sweilam
4个回答

5

REST API已被弃用。

正确的方法是将配置文件名称传递给Graph API。

请参阅:Facebook ID from URL


5

仍在工作,但现在需要访问令牌来读取资源。请参阅https://developers.facebook.com/docs/graph-api/using-graph-api/?locale=en_US获取更多信息。 - Duong Nguyen
2
这已经被弃用了。 - Hideya

-1
截至2015年7月28日,我发现一种不同的方法来从Facebook用户的个人资料网址(或用户名)中找到数字ID。
正如大家所知,个人资料网址语法是https://www.facebook.com/[用户名] 因此,只需浏览至个人资料网址,右键单击查看源代码并搜索字符串“uid”:。您将在其旁边得到数字ID。

4
废物处理方案!需要一个更通用的代码解决方案。 - user3681970

-2
使用Users.getInfo,该方法返回一个用户信息数组,包括first_namelast_nameuid等。使用此调用来获取您打算显示给其他用户(例如您的应用程序用户)的用户数据。如果您需要一些用于分析目的的基本用户信息,请改为调用users.getStandardInfo

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接